Why standard mattresses fail for 230+ lb sleepers

The biomechanical reality: most mattresses are engineered for the 130-200 lb range. Above 230 lbs, the sustained pressure on coils and foam compresses the materials past their designed limits. Standard 14-15 gauge coils bend faster. Standard 1.8-3 lb foam packs and compresses permanently. The result is premature sagging, body impressions within 2-4 years, and growing back/hip pain as alignment degrades.

Heavy-duty mattresses solve this with three engineering choices: thicker coils (12-13 gauge instead of 14-15), higher density foam (5+ lb instead of 1.8-3 lb), and reinforced perimeter (heavier-gauge coils or double-encasement at edges). Look for all three; one alone isn’t enough.

Mattresses rated for average sleepers (130-180 lbs) often fail people who weigh 230 lbs or more: coils bottom out, foam sags prematurely, and edge support collapses. The best mattresses for heavier sleepers use reinforced coil systems, high-density foam bases, and thicker profiles to maintain support and durability over years of use.

Key Features for Heavier Sleepers

Coil gauge and count: Heavier gauge coils (13-15 gauge) resist deformation under sustained pressure. the company uses 13-gauge tempered steel — among the most durable in the industry. Thin foam-only mattresses typically lack the structural integrity for long-term support above 230 lbs.

High-density foam base: Look for 1.8+ lb/cu ft density in the support layers. Lower-density foam compresses permanently within 2-3 years under higher body weight, causing the dreaded body impression.

Reinforced edge support: Heavy sleepers compress edges more aggressively during ingress/egress. Perimeter coil reinforcement prevents edge roll-off and extends the usable sleeping surface.

Is memory foam bad for heavy people?
Standard memory foam (2-4 lb density) compresses permanently faster under higher weight. High-density memory foam (5 lb+) performs better but still tends to trap heat. Coil hybrids like Saatva provide better long-term durability and cooling for most heavier sleepers.
Should heavy sleepers choose a firmer mattress?
Generally yes — heavier body weight compresses the mattress more, so a firm base prevents bottoming out. However, very firm mattresses without a comfort layer can cause pressure points. Saatva Classic Firm (8/10) with its thin euro pillow-top hits the right balance.
